Mechanism Study of Yangyin Roujin Formula in the Treatment of Fibromyalgia Syndrome

This prospective randomized, double-blind, controlled clinical trial is designed to address the current challenges in the clinical management of fibromyalgia (FM). We adopt Yangyin Roujin Formula, an empirical herbal prescription used in routine clinical practice, to evaluate its comprehensive therapeutic efficacy and safety in FM patients, including alleviating physical pain and common concomitant symptoms, improving physical function, and enhancing quality of life. Serum and fecal samples as well as brain MRI scans will be collected at baseline and after 12 weeks of intervention. The underlying mechanisms of this formula will be explored from multiple dimensions, including serology, gut microbiota-metabolome profiling, and central neuroimaging, so as to clarify the therapeutic advantages of Yangyin Roujin Formula for FM treatment.

Participants needed: 60
